Job Summary
As an Automation Engineer, you will be responsible for developing and deploying automation solutions to improve the efficiency, reliability, and security of our Windows, Linux, and cloud infrastructure. You will join a team of engineers who support various configuration and services, such as Active Directory, Exchange, SharePoint, SQL Server, Azure, GCP, and AW S. You will also collaborate with other teams and stakeholders to ensure alignment on best practices, standards, and policies.
Responsibilities
- Design and implement automation solutions using PowerShell, Ansible, Terraform, Jenkins, Python, or other tools, to streamline and optimize operational processes, such as provisioning, configuration, patching, backup, recovery, monitoring, and auditing.
- Engineer solutions utilizing C#, C++, JavaScript, and .Net languages.
- Manage the Windows and Linux infrastructure across multiple sites and environments, ensuring high availability, performance, and scalability.
- Troubleshoot and resolve complex issues related to Windows and Linux infrastructure and automation, as well as provide root cause analysis and remediation plans.
- Follow Windows and Linux infrastructure and automation standards, guidelines, and procedures, and conduct regular reviews and audits to ensure compliance.
- Assist with planning, coordination, and execution of Windows and Linux infrastructure and automation projects, including scoping, budgeting, scheduling, resourcing, risk management, and stakeholder communication.
- Research and evaluate new technologies and solutions that can improve the Windows and Linux infrastructure and automation capabilities of the company.
- Integrate automation solutions with third-party tools and services to ensure seamless collaboration across multiple platforms.
